Solve Your Coding Challenges in Record Time with StackOverflow Plus ChatGPT Plugin
As a programmer, you know the frustration of getting stuck on a coding problem and spending hours scouring the internet for answers. It‘s an all-too-common scenario that can grind your productivity to a halt. But what if there was a tool that could provide instant, accurate solutions to your programming questions without ever leaving your workflow?
Enter StackOverflow Plus – the revolutionary ChatGPT plugin that brings the power of StackOverflow directly into your conversation. With StackOverflow Plus, you can tap into the collective knowledge of the world‘s largest programming community and get the answers you need in seconds, not hours.
The Problem with Traditional StackOverflow Search
For years, StackOverflow has been the go-to resource for programmers seeking help with coding challenges. With over 21 million questions and 33 million answers, it‘s an invaluable repository of programming knowledge. However, navigating this vast database can be a daunting task, especially when you‘re in the middle of a project and need answers fast.
Traditional StackOverflow search relies on keyword matching and basic algorithms to surface relevant results. While this approach can be effective for simple queries, it often falls short when dealing with more complex, nuanced questions. As a result, developers can spend hours scrolling through pages of irrelevant results, trying to find the needle in the haystack.
Consider these sobering statistics:
- The average developer spends 21% of their time searching for answers and debugging code (Source: StackOverflow Developer Survey 2022)
- 40% of developers say that finding answers to coding questions is their biggest challenge (Source: CodinGame Developer Survey 2021)
- Developers spend an average of 30 minutes per coding task searching for solutions on StackOverflow (Source: StackOverflow Internal Data)
Clearly, there‘s a need for a more efficient, intelligent way to search StackOverflow and find the answers developers need to stay productive.
How StackOverflow Plus Revolutionizes Coding Problem-Solving
StackOverflow Plus represents a quantum leap forward in programming problem-solving. By leveraging the power of artificial intelligence and natural language processing, StackOverflow Plus is able to understand the intent and context behind your questions and provide highly targeted, relevant answers.
Under the hood, StackOverflow Plus uses advanced machine learning algorithms to analyze the vast StackOverflow database and extract insights that traditional search methods miss. When you ask a question, the plugin breaks it down into its key components, considering factors like:
- The programming language and framework you‘re using
- The specific error or issue you‘re encountering
- The context and intent behind your question
- Related concepts and terminology
Armed with this deep understanding, StackOverflow Plus is able to surface the most relevant answers and present them in a clear, concise format. No more wading through pages of irrelevant results – just the information you need to solve your problem and get back to coding.
But StackOverflow Plus isn‘t just a smarter search engine. It‘s a conversational assistant that can engage in back-and-forth dialogue to help you clarify your questions and find the best possible solutions. Just like a knowledgeable coworker or mentor, StackOverflow Plus is there to guide you through your coding challenges and provide expert advice at every step.
StackOverflow Plus vs Other AI Coding Assistants
StackOverflow Plus isn‘t the only AI-powered coding assistant on the market. Tools like GitHub Copilot and TabNine have gained popularity in recent years for their ability to autocomplete code and provide intelligent suggestions. However, StackOverflow Plus stands out from the crowd in several key ways:
StackOverflow Integration: While other AI assistants rely on their own proprietary algorithms and datasets, StackOverflow Plus is built on top of the world‘s largest programming knowledge base. This means you have access to a much broader range of solutions and perspectives.
Conversational Interface: StackOverflow Plus is designed to be used within the context of a conversation, whether that‘s with ChatGPT or another AI assistant. This allows for a more natural, intuitive interaction that feels like talking to a real person.
Transparency and Trust: Because StackOverflow Plus sources its answers directly from the StackOverflow community, you can have confidence in the accuracy and reliability of the information provided. Each answer includes a link back to the original StackOverflow post, so you can dig deeper and learn from the experts.
Language Agnostic: While some AI coding assistants are limited to specific languages or frameworks, StackOverflow Plus can handle questions across the full spectrum of programming topics. Whether you‘re working in Python, JavaScript, C++, or any other language, StackOverflow Plus has you covered.
Real-World Impact: StackOverflow Plus in Action
To truly understand the power of StackOverflow Plus, it‘s helpful to look at some real-world examples of how the plugin is being used by developers around the world.
One early adopter is Sarah, a full-stack developer working on a complex web application. Sarah frequently runs into tricky JavaScript issues that can take hours to debug. With StackOverflow Plus, she‘s able to get instant, targeted answers to her questions without ever leaving her code editor.
"StackOverflow Plus has been a game-changer for me," Sarah says. "Instead of spending hours scrolling through StackOverflow threads, I can just ask my question and get the answer I need in seconds. It‘s like having a JavaScript expert on speed dial."
Another satisfied user is Mark, a data scientist who uses Python to build machine learning models. Mark often encounters obscure error messages and edge cases that can be difficult to troubleshoot. With StackOverflow Plus, he‘s able to quickly identify the root cause of the problem and find a solution.
"I love how StackOverflow Plus is able to understand the nuances of my questions," Mark says. "Even when I‘m not sure exactly what I‘m looking for, the plugin is able to point me in the right direction and provide the guidance I need to get unstuck."
But StackOverflow Plus isn‘t just for experienced developers. It‘s also a valuable tool for students and new programmers who are just learning the ropes. By providing instant access to expert answers and explanations, StackOverflow Plus can help accelerate the learning process and build confidence.
Samantha, a computer science student, relies on StackOverflow Plus to help her navigate the complexities of her coursework. "As a beginner, it can be overwhelming trying to figure out how to solve coding problems on my own," she says. "With StackOverflow Plus, I feel like I have a personal tutor who can help me work through challenges and understand the underlying concepts."
Tips for Getting the Most Out of StackOverflow Plus
While StackOverflow Plus is incredibly powerful out of the box, there are a few tips and tricks you can use to get even more value from the plugin:
Be Specific: The more specific and targeted your question, the better results you‘ll get from StackOverflow Plus. Avoid vague or overly broad queries and instead focus on the core issue you‘re trying to solve.
Provide Context: Whenever possible, include relevant details about your programming environment, such as the language, framework, and version you‘re using. This will help StackOverflow Plus provide more accurate and relevant answers.
Use Code Snippets: If you‘re encountering a specific error or issue, include a code snippet or stack trace in your question. This will give StackOverflow Plus more context to work with and help identify potential solutions.
Engage in Dialogue: Don‘t be afraid to ask follow-up questions or seek clarification from StackOverflow Plus. The plugin is designed to facilitate a natural, back-and-forth conversation to help you get to the bottom of your issue.
Upvote and Share: When you find a particularly helpful answer from StackOverflow Plus, consider upvoting it on the original StackOverflow post. This helps surface high-quality content for other users and supports the StackOverflow community.
The Future of AI-Assisted Programming
StackOverflow Plus is just the beginning of a new era of AI-assisted programming. As machine learning and natural language processing continue to advance, we can expect to see even more powerful tools and platforms emerge to help developers work smarter and faster.
Some potential future developments include:
Predictive Debugging: Imagine a tool that could automatically identify potential bugs and issues in your code before they cause problems. By analyzing patterns and anomalies, AI-powered debuggers could help developers catch and fix errors early in the development process.
Intelligent Code Review: Code review is an essential part of the software development lifecycle, but it can be time-consuming and tedious. AI-assisted code review tools could automatically identify potential issues and suggest improvements, saving developers time and effort.
Personalized Learning: By analyzing a developer‘s skill level, learning style, and areas of interest, AI-powered learning platforms could provide personalized recommendations and resources to help them grow and improve their skills over time.
As these and other AI-powered tools continue to evolve, it‘s clear that the future of programming is bright. By leveraging the power of machine learning and natural language processing, developers will be able to work more efficiently, effectively, and creatively than ever before.
Conclusion
In a world where time is money and every second counts, StackOverflow Plus is a tool that no programmer can afford to be without. By providing instant, accurate answers to even the most complex coding questions, StackOverflow Plus empowers developers to work smarter, not harder.
Whether you‘re a seasoned pro or just starting out, StackOverflow Plus has something to offer. So why wait? Sign up for StackOverflow Plus today and start experiencing the future of programming problem-solving.
With StackOverflow Plus by your side, there‘s no limit to what you can achieve. Happy coding!